This release changes the Corvandel public REST API from offset pagination to cursor tokens. Roll out behind the `cursor_pages` flag; offset parameters remain accepted for two release cycles with a deprecation header. Before enabling the flag in production, confirm the gateway config bundle validates — the gateway refuses unsigned bundles outright. Canary on the Dresmuth region first and watch 4xx rates for thirty minutes. The config bundle must be signed prior to upload; the key used for that step appears below.

signing key of bagap-yawep = bky13_TbfT6ZMUoGJo2

**CI note — StageGrid seat-map renderer.** Renderer snapshot tests flake on the Orpington Hall fixture when the runner uses the headless font stack: glyph metrics shift, row labels wrap, diffs fail. Workaround: pin the font bundle in the CI image; do not bump it with base-image updates. If it recurs, regenerate snapshots on the pinned image only. Affected builds carry the token below.

pipeline stamp: htk21_86b657ac0aa916a9af17f

Subject: Key rotation for the Glimmerpress render API

Hi plugin folks,

Quick heads-up: we're rotating keys for the Glimmerpress template-rendering service this Friday. The new render pipeline is roughly 40% faster on nested partials, so your plugins should feel snappier without any changes. Old keys stop working Monday morning. If you test against our internal sandbox, swap in the new key pasted just below this line.

gateway credential: kto11_pTkcHgLwuNE

Subject: Cron drift investigation — interim findings

Team, we've traced the delayed nightly jobs on the Hollowgate scheduler to clock drift on two worker hosts after a hypervisor migration. Jobs were firing up to four minutes late, which explains the stale report complaints. NTP has been re-pinned and we're monitoring overnight. If customers ask, reference the patched build noted below.

build token for fahap-yagag: htk3_d09

Ticket: Vault lockout blocking consent banner rollout

The Quillhaven deploy vault auto-locked after three failed unseal attempts during last night's consent banner push for the Marrowfield regions. New folks: this is expected behavior, not an outage. The banner config is staged and ready; only the vault stands between us and rollout. Ops confirmed the lock timer has expired, so anyone on the team can now re-open it. Unseal using the recovery passphrase below.

vault phrase of yagag-kadup = belael-druius-rusax-kelox